Recreational drones in Euless follow FAA rules. DFW Class B airspace covers the entire city, requiring LAANC authorization before flying. TX Gov Code 423 limits drone surveillance imagery.
Recreational drone operation in Euless is complicated by the city's unique airspace situation. Euless sits directly adjacent to Dallas Fort Worth International Airport and lies entirely within DFW's Class B controlled airspace, extending from the surface up to 10,000 feet over portions of the city. Under FAA rules, all drone flights in Class B surface-level airspace require prior authorization through the Low Altitude Authorization and Notification Capability (LAANC) system or via the DroneZone portal for operations at or below posted ceiling altitudes. In most of Euless, the published LAANC ceiling is zero feet, meaning no drone flight is authorized without case-by-case approval. Recreational flyers must also pass the TRUST (The Recreational UAS Safety Test), register any drone weighing more than 0.55 pounds with the FAA, and fly under a Community-Based Organization safety code. Drones must stay below 400 feet AGL, maintain visual line of sight, remain clear of manned aircraft, and not fly over people or moving vehicles without authorization. Texas Government Code Chapter 423 adds state-level rules prohibiting use of a drone to capture images of an individual or privately-owned real property with intent to surveil, with limited exceptions. Flying over critical infrastructure like utility substations is specifically prohibited. Flying during TSA-designated sporting events and over DFW itself is always prohibited. Violations can lead to FAA civil penalties up to $32,000 per violation plus state misdemeanor charges. Euless Police respond to drone complaints and coordinate with FAA as needed.
